Top 4 Natural Monuments around gmina Aleksandrów Kujawski

Best natural monuments around gmina Aleksandrów Kujawski offer diverse natural landscapes and significant ecological areas. This region is characterized by its position within the Vistula River valley, featuring unique microclimates and riparian environments. The area includes parts of the Puszcza Bydgoska forest complex and the Tążyna River valley, providing varied forest types. Visitors can explore protected trees and expansive natural areas that contribute to the region's natural heritage.

Railway disaster near Otłoczyn. On August 19, 1980, there was a train crash in this place, in which 67 people died. At 4:35 a.m., passenger and freight trains collided.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of natural monuments can I find in Gmina Aleksandrów Kujawski?

Gmina Aleksandrów Kujawski features a diverse range of natural monuments. You'll find impressive individual protected trees, such as ancient oaks and linden trees, as well as broader natural areas like the Vistula River valley within the "Nizina Ciechocińska" Protected Landscape Area, and parts of the Puszcza Bydgoska forest complex. The region is characterized by its unique microclimate and riparian landscapes.

Are there any significant trees designated as natural monuments in the region?

Yes, the region is home to several notable protected trees. For instance, the Zespół Szkół Nr 1 Centrum Kształcenia Praktycznego hosts 12 protected natural monuments, including one linden tree and eleven oak trees, some reaching 20 meters in height. Another prominent oak tree stands on Słowackiego Street at the City and Commune Office. Additionally, the Magnolia Tree in Nieszawa is a natural monument, particularly beautiful when it flowers in early April.

What is the "Nizina Ciechocińska" Protected Landscape Area known for?

The "Nizina Ciechocińska" Protected Landscape Area is significant for its unique microclimate, which supports the nearby Ciechocinek health resort, and its beautiful riparian landscape along the Vistula River valley. It's a crucial area for bird species, serving as a breeding ground and winter resting place, and provides vital habitats for amphibians in its oxbow lakes. The well-developed riparian forests also offer numerous nesting sites for cavity-nesting birds.

Can I observe wildlife at the natural monuments?

Yes, the natural areas, particularly within the "Nizina Ciechocińska" Protected Landscape Area and along the Tążyna River valley, are rich in wildlife. The Vistula valley is important for rare and endangered bird species, while oxbow lakes provide habitats for amphibians. The riparian forests are home to cavity-nesting birds, and the broader Puszcza Bydgoska complex supports diverse forest fauna.

What are the Puszcza Bydgoska and Tążyna River Valley like in this region?

The northern and north-eastern parts of Gmina Aleksandrów Kujawski fall within the Puszcza Bydgoska forest complex, characterized by mixed forests and pine monocultures. The Tążyna River valley, especially within the city, maintains a near-natural state with alder, willow-poplar, and hornbeam forests. These areas are excellent for walks and experiencing the local wilderness.
